About Us

Woodlands Physiotherapy & Sports Injuries Clinic, located at 91 Liverpool Road, Hutton, Preston, is a well-established clinic providing expert physiotherapy services. The clinic is led by Sara Blackhurst, a highly experienced Chartered Physiotherapist with an impressive background in elite sports physiotherapy. Sara has worked at major international events, including the Sydney 2000 and Athens 2004 Paralympic Games, as well as the Manchester 2002 Commonwealth Games. She has supported Great Britain’s Men’s Wheelchair Basketball and Visually Impaired Judo teams, demonstrating her expertise in both able-bodied and disabled sports.

The team at Woodlands combines extensive experience from various settings, including NHS hospitals, private practices, and industry. Their expertise spans ergonomic assessments, workplace injury treatments, and general physiotherapy. This breadth of knowledge allows the clinic to offer a high-quality, patient-centred service tailored to individual needs.

Other physiotherapists at the clinic bring diverse skills from their work with recreational and elite athletes across a range of sports such as tennis, rugby, swimming, and gymnastics. Several of them also maintain roles within the NHS, ensuring that Woodlands combines private sector innovation with the highest public healthcare standards.

Services

Woodlands Physiotherapy & Sports Injuries Clinic specialises in the assessment, diagnosis, and treatment of a wide range of musculoskeletal conditions and sports injuries. The clinic provides tailored rehabilitation programmes designed to optimise recovery and restore function. Treatment approaches include manual therapy, exercise therapy, and pain management techniques.

The clinic’s services cover injuries sustained in both sporting and non-sporting environments. They offer expert care for acute injuries, chronic pain, post-operative rehabilitation, and workplace-related disorders. Additionally, Woodlands offers ergonomic assessments to help clients improve posture and reduce injury risk in their working environments.

Sports-specific physiotherapy forms a core part of the clinic’s offerings. Therapists work closely with athletes to enhance performance, prevent injury, and ensure safe return to sport after injury.
